Liverpool Eye Contract Clarity with Salah and Van Dijk Set to Sign New Deals

Key figures nearing fresh terms

At a time when transition defines Liverpool’s present, continuity could soon ease anxieties at Anfield. Mohamed Salah and Virgil van Dijk – two players whose influence cannot be overstated – are reportedly on the verge of signing new contracts that will extend their stays into the twilight of their glittering careers.

According to Fabrizio Romano, via GiveMeSport, Liverpool are working hard behind the scenes to get both deals over the line. “Liverpool maintain their confidence that both Salah and Van Dijk will stay and sign new deals. The club absolutely want to get it done ASAP, as Trent is getting closer and closer to Real Madrid,” Romano explained.

While Trent Alexander-Arnold edges towards the Bernabéu, these renewals are being positioned not just as statements of intent but as necessary anchors for Arne Slot’s new era.

Timing is everything for Liverpool

The urgency within Liverpool’s hierarchy is understandable. Securing the long-term futures of Salah and Van Dijk now – before Trent’s likely departure becomes official – would provide a much-needed lift for supporters and the squad alike. It is about setting a tone. About proving the club remains ambitious and stable, even amid inevitable change.

For much of the season, the contract stand-offs involving both players have cast long shadows over Liverpool’s progress. There’s been tension, speculation, and the creeping sense that a golden era was slowly fading. Now, the clarity fans have craved appears to be on the horizon.

Players pushing for resolution

It isn’t just the club that wants this resolved. According to Romano, both Salah and Van Dijk are keen to move forward too. “Salah and Van Dijk themselves will be more relieved than anyone when their new deals with the Reds are finally announced in the coming weeks.”

Neither has ever publicly agitated for a move – their silence has often spoken of loyalty – but uncertainty has clouded their influence this season. With these new deals, they can step into 2025 and beyond knowing they are part of Liverpool’s vision.

Foundation for the next chapter

If and when these contracts are finalised, the focus can shift to what’s next: reshaping a team that can challenge on all fronts again. Losing Trent Alexander-Arnold will hurt. There’s no softening that blow. But securing Salah and Van Dijk ensures that two pillars remain – a spine still strong enough to hold up a title charge.
